    <p>I've used regular 'green stuff' with distilled water--deionized
      is fine, too--for over 130K miles in my BJ8 with no
      cooling/coolant issues (roughly 40/60 AF/water).  You can use more
      water if there's no chance of a freeze, and you'll get slightly
      better cooling.  Chances are, you'll be draining and replacing
      your coolant occasionally for reasons not necessarily related to
      the cooling system anyway.</p>
    <p>The OAT stuff should work fine, but the article mentions a
      potential contamination problem.   The Castrol seems a bit dear;
      regular Prestone 'green' goes for about $17/gallon over here, and
      a gallon gives about a 40/60 water/AF mix which is good down to
      below freezing.  I recently had my engine overhauled and there was
      no scale or sludge to speak of.<br>
